本文目录导读:
随着信息技术的飞速发展,云计算已成为企业数字化转型的重要驱动力,而云计算平台虚拟化软件作为云计算的核心技术之一,其重要性不言而喻,本文将从虚拟化软件的定义、发展历程、关键技术、应用场景等方面进行探讨,旨在揭示云计算平台虚拟化软件在构建未来数字化生态中的关键作用。
虚拟化软件的定义及发展历程
1、定义
图片来源于网络,如有侵权联系删除
虚拟化软件是一种技术,通过将物理资源(如服务器、存储、网络等)抽象化,形成多个虚拟资源,实现对物理资源的灵活配置和高效利用,虚拟化软件主要包括虚拟机管理程序、虚拟存储管理程序、虚拟网络管理程序等。
2、发展历程
虚拟化技术起源于20世纪70年代,最初应用于大型机领域,随着计算机硬件和软件技术的不断发展,虚拟化技术逐渐应用于服务器、存储、网络等领域,近年来,随着云计算的兴起,虚拟化技术得到了广泛关注和应用。
云计算平台虚拟化软件的关键技术
1、虚拟机管理程序
虚拟机管理程序(Virtual Machine Manager,VMM)是虚拟化软件的核心组件,负责创建、管理、监控虚拟机,其主要技术包括:
(1)虚拟化技术:通过硬件辅助虚拟化、软件虚拟化等方式实现物理资源向虚拟资源的转换。
(2)虚拟机调度:根据系统负载、资源利用率等因素,合理分配虚拟机资源。
(3)虚拟机迁移:实现虚拟机在不同物理主机之间的迁移,提高系统可用性和可靠性。
2、虚拟存储管理程序
虚拟存储管理程序(Virtual Storage Manager,VSM)负责虚拟机的存储资源管理,其主要技术包括:
图片来源于网络,如有侵权联系删除
(1)存储虚拟化:将物理存储资源抽象化为虚拟存储资源,实现存储资源的灵活分配和高效利用。
(2)快照技术:实现虚拟机的快速备份和恢复。
(3)存储优化:通过压缩、去重等技术提高存储资源利用率。
3、虚拟网络管理程序
虚拟网络管理程序(Virtual Network Manager,VNM)负责虚拟机的网络资源管理,其主要技术包括:
(1)虚拟交换机:实现虚拟机之间的网络通信。
(2)网络虚拟化:将物理网络资源抽象化为虚拟网络资源,实现网络资源的灵活配置和高效利用。
(3)网络优化:通过QoS、流量整形等技术提高网络性能。
云计算平台虚拟化软件的应用场景
1、数据中心
虚拟化技术广泛应用于数据中心,通过提高资源利用率、降低能耗、简化运维等方式,实现数据中心的绿色、高效运行。
图片来源于网络,如有侵权联系删除
2、云计算平台
云计算平台是虚拟化技术的典型应用场景,通过虚拟化技术实现资源的灵活配置和高效利用,降低企业IT成本。
3、虚拟化桌面
虚拟化桌面技术将桌面操作系统虚拟化,实现集中管理、远程访问,提高办公效率。
4、容器化平台
容器化技术是基于虚拟化技术的一种轻量级虚拟化技术,通过虚拟化操作系统内核,实现应用程序的隔离和高效运行。
云计算平台虚拟化软件作为云计算的核心技术之一,在构建未来数字化生态中发挥着关键作用,随着虚拟化技术的不断发展,虚拟化软件将更加成熟、高效,为企业和个人提供更加优质的服务。
标签: #云计算平台虚拟化软件
评论列表